Defining the Smartwatch Glyph Icon Style
A "glyph" icon is typically characterized by its solid, monochromatic form. Unlike realistic illustrations or skeuomorphic designs that mimic 3D textures and lighting, glyphs focus on distinct silhouettes and simplified geometry. The Smartwatch Glyph Icon approach prioritizes instant recognition over artistic detail.
The primary distinction of a glyph style is its versatility. Because it relies on a single color (often black or white, though easily customizable), it integrates seamlessly into diverse user interfaces without clashing with an existing color palette. This style aligns with modern design trends that favor minimalism and functional clarity. When a user sees a smartwatch glyph, they do not need to process complex visual data; the shape alone conveys the meaning of "wearable tech" or "health monitoring."
The Critical Role of File Format Diversity
When evaluating icon resources, the specific file formats included in the package are often more important than the visual design itself. A robust Smartwatch Glyph Icon package typically includes a variety of formats to accommodate different workflows. A standard high-quality pack might include AI, EPS, JPG, PNG, and SVG files.
Understanding the function of each format helps in assessing the value of the resource:
- Vector Formats (AI, EPS, SVG): These are the most critical for professional design. Vector files use mathematical equations rather than pixels to draw shapes. This means a Smartwatch Glyph Icon can be scaled from the size of a watch face to a billboard without losing quality. The SVG (Scalable Vector Graphics) format is particularly vital for web and mobile app development because it offers small file sizes and high resolution on any screen density.
- Raster Formats (JPG, PNG): While vectors are superior for editing, raster formats are necessary for immediate use. PNG files are essential because they support transparency. A Smartwatch Glyph Icon in PNG format allows designers to place the icon over complex backgrounds or photographs without a white box surrounding it. JPG files are useful for presentations or documents where transparency is not required and file size needs to be minimized.
The inclusion of a transparent background in the PNG and SVG files is a non-negotiable feature for modern UI design, allowing the icon to float naturally within a layout.

Comparing Glyph Icons to Other Visual Options
When sourcing a smartwatch visual, creators usually compare three main categories: stock photography, detailed illustrations, and glyph icons.
Stock Photography offers realism but often lacks flexibility. You cannot easily change the color of a watch band in a photo, and photos can become dated quickly as hardware designs change. They also tend to have large file sizes and can slow down website loading times.
Detailed Illustrations offer a unique brand personality but can be visually "busy." In a dense user interface, a detailed illustration of a smartwatch can distract the user from the content or function it is meant to represent.
The Smartwatch Glyph Icon strikes a balance. It is functional rather than decorative. It is the best fit for UI/UX design, technical documentation, and minimalist branding. However, it may be the wrong choice if the goal is to showcase the physical hardware in a realistic product catalog. In that scenario, photography is superior.
Practical Applications and Best-Fit Scenarios
The versatility of the Smartwatch Glyph Icon makes it suitable for a wide range of applications, but it excels in specific areas.
- Mobile App Navigation: In a mobile health or fitness app, a small, crisp smartwatch glyph is perfect for the bottom navigation bar or a settings menu. It communicates "wearable sync" without taking up valuable screen real estate.
- Web Design and Templates: For tech blogs, SaaS landing pages, or e-commerce sites selling accessories, these icons serve as visual anchors for feature lists. They help break up text and guide the reader's eye to key benefits.
- Presentations and Pitch Decks: When presenting data about IoT (Internet of Things) or wearable market trends, a clean Smartwatch Glyph Icon adds a professional touch to slides without overwhelming the data.
- Print Media: Because the set includes vector formats (AI/EPS), the icons can be used in high-resolution print materials like brochures or packaging labels without any loss of sharpness.
